An expansive labyrinth, with ethereal traces drawing the context, a proposal without borders, where the limit between the object and the surrounding space introduce us to open, dynamic forms to create the illusion of movement and volatility.
Guillermo Anselmo Vezzosi is an artist who models and modulates his drawings, using playful, negative/positive spaces and their shadows to create unique and fleeting compositions.
In his works, the line –as an initial element and concept- advances, unfolds and leaves the formal plane of representation to compose ethereal installations.
He creates suspended scenarios that are modified by the personal experience of that other whom he invites to participate. Through a crackling of colors and territories to explore, he suggests a singular universe, populated by complex constellations.
In a multiplied evolution of gazes, the dialogue with the observer-actor on which the work is reconstructed is gestated, that great vibrant fabric.
